Transaction a8c266cabb0a9656580e38cf660a0763d94f173a357ea02475c8b5e5694f2c03
1 Input
1 Output
-
a8c266cabb0a9656580e38cf660a0763d94f173a357ea02475c8b5e5694f2c03:0
- value
- 864310
- script pubkey
- OP_0 OP_PUSHBYTES_20 3df7192373ccbd5b7de162c1c687617cc179f0cf
- address
- bc1q8hm3jgmnej74kl0pvtqudpmp0nqhnux0yl40nh